tf.raw_ops.ParameterizedTruncatedNormal
Outputs random values from a normal distribution. The parameters may each be a
tf.raw_ops.ParameterizedTruncatedNormal(
    shape, means, stdevs, minvals, maxvals, seed=0, seed2=0, name=None
)
  scalar which applies to the entire output, or a vector of length shape[0] which stores the parameters for each batch.
| Args | |
|---|---|
shape | 
      A Tensor. Must be one of the following types: int32, int64. The shape of the output tensor. Batches are indexed by the 0th dimension. | 
     
means | 
      A Tensor. Must be one of the following types: half, bfloat16, float32, float64. The mean parameter of each batch. | 
     
stdevs | 
      A Tensor. Must have the same type as means. The standard deviation parameter of each batch. Must be greater than 0. | 
     
minvals | 
      A Tensor. Must have the same type as means. The minimum cutoff. May be -infinity. | 
     
maxvals | 
      A Tensor. Must have the same type as means. The maximum cutoff. May be +infinity, and must be more than the minval for each batch. | 
     
seed | 
      An optional int. Defaults to 0. If either seed or seed2 are set to be non-zero, the random number generator is seeded by the given seed. Otherwise, it is seeded by a random seed. | 
     
seed2 | 
      An optional int. Defaults to 0. A second seed to avoid seed collision. | 
     
name | 
      A name for the operation (optional). | 
| Returns | |
|---|---|
A Tensor. Has the same type as means. |
